Job description

At Compass, our mission is to help everyone find their place in the world. Founded in 2012, we’re revolutionizing the real estate industry with our end-to-end platform that empowers residential real estate agents to deliver exceptional service to seller and buyer clients.

About the Role:

We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Lead Data Scientist to join our data science team. In this role, you will leverage your deep expertise in machine learning, statistical modeling, and data analysis to solve our most complex problems. You will set the standard for data science excellence, architect scalable solutions, and help define the long-term analytical strategy. You will partner with senior business stakeholders and engineering leaders to uncover insights, develop cutting‑edge data‑driven solutions, and drive initiatives that directly shape company‑wide strategic planning, resource allocation, and product innovation.

Responsibilities:
  • Lead the end‑to‑end development, validation, and deployment of large‑scale predictive models and algorithms that inform strategic business decisions and market trend analysis.
  • Design and execute rigorous data‑driven research to analyze the impact of multi‑faceted factors on business outcomes, tackling the organization’s most highly ambiguous and open‑ended problems.
  • Collaborate deeply with senior business stakeholders and engineering partners to identify strategic opportunities, translate overarching business goals into complex analytical frameworks, and deliver high‑impact actionable insights.
  • Synthesize and communicate highly complex methodologies, technical trade‑offs, and strategic findings clearly to both C‑level executives and technical audiences.
  • Act as a technical mentor to other data scientists, fostering a culture of continuous learning, rigorous peer review, and adherence to state‑of‑the‑art methodologies.
Qualifications:
  • Master's degree or PhD in Computer Science, Statistics, Economics, Mathematics, or a related quantitative field.
  • 5+ years of experience in data science with a proven track record of conceptualizing, leading, and delivering highly successful, end‑to‑end data science projects.
  • Deep expertise in key data science domains (e.g., time‑series forecasting, deep learning, causal inference).
  • Extensive practical experience architecting solutions using a broad range of methodologies (e.g., prediction, segmentation, NLP).
  • Demonstrated proficiency in Python and SQL for complex data manipulation, statistical analysis, and model development.
  • Hands‑on experience productionizing machine learning models and strong familiarity with MLOps concepts and workflows.
  • Proven experience leading complex, cross‑functional projects and applying advanced methodologies to solve ambiguous business problems.
  • Strong advocate for clean code principles, software engineering best practices, and technical standards.
  • Strong business acumen and strategic thinking, with a proven ability to understand the broader business context, evaluate tradeoffs, and align analytical projects with organizational goals.
  • Experience mentoring and guiding junior team members, overseeing project quality, and investigating root causes of complex technical challenges.
  • Exceptional communication and collaboration skills, with a proven ability to work effectively in a fast‑paced, cross‑functional environment.
  • Experience in the Real Estate industry or other market‑driven domains is a plus.
Compensation:

The base pay range for this position is $175,500-195,000 annually; however, base pay offered may vary depending on job‑related knowledge, skills, and experience. Bonuses and restricted stock units may be provided as part of the compensation package, in addition to a full range of benefits. Base pay is based on market location. Minimum wage for the position will always be met.
